Method

Preparation Steps

1

Prepare the Walla Walla Onion Jam

In a saucepan, combine chopped Walla Walla onions, sugar, and red wine vinegar. Cook over medium heat until the onions are soft and the mixture thickens, about 30 minutes. Set aside to cool.

2

Poach the Sweetbreads

In a skillet, heat duck fat over low heat. Add the veal sweetbreads that have been cleaned and soaked in cold water for a couple of hours. Poach for about 20-25 minutes until tender. Remove and let cool slightly.

3

Prepare the Beef Demi-Glace

In a saucepan, heat the beef demi-glace until warm. Season with salt and pepper to taste.

4

Assemble the Sliders

Slice the poached sweetbreads into manageable pieces. Place a piece on the bottom half of each slider bun, add a spoonful of Walla Walla onion jam, a few pickled mustard seeds, and drizzle with beef demi-glace. Top with the other half of the bun.

5

Serve

Serve the sweetbread sliders warm with your favorite sides and enjoy!
